Equilibrium in Two-Player Nonzero-Sum Dynkin Games in Continuous Time
Résumé
We prove that every two-player nonzero-sum Dynkin game in continuous time admits an "epsilon" equilibrium in randomized stopping times. We provide a condition that ensures the existence of an "epsilon" equilibrium in nonrandomized stopping times.
